Since I’ve been writing a little mini series on blogging this week – I am jumping into Mama Kat’s writing workshop at the last minute to answer the question – What does blogging mean to me.

I started blogging a little over 4 years ago and have struggled, at times, to keep up with it. I often  wonder why I don’t just give it up.

I started my blog knowing nothing about internet business but determined to do something besides parenting. I gave up my career to stay home with my kids – and was going to be just 2 kids and a few years of my life – turned into 4 kids and fourteen years. I love being a mom – but I needed something else to challenge me, something that didn’t have anything to do with cute little people.

Blogging – for me was an outlet.

But the learning curve was high and the rewards (meaning moolah) was not rolling in. Everyone else with a website seemed to know so much more than I, and seemed to be much more successful.

Blogging became extremely time consuming. And yet I trudged on.

I read everything I could find about creating a successful blog. I followed one web guru and then another and then another. And I learned a lot.

But I didn’t blog much. And yet I still could not give up.

And then I got an offer – from someone that wanted to buy my blog. The offer was reasonable, but on an emotional level – way to low for all the time spent.

And that is when I knew the answer to the question – What does blogging mean to me. The real question is “what does THIS blog mean to me?”

Over the years – this blog has become an old friend. It is a neglected friendship with oh, so much potential.

And so I have resolved to put the time and energy into making this site shine.

Join the conversation – and tell me – what does blogging mean to you.
